SRCL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2013 in Review

560 of the 3,445 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Stericycle Inc (SRCL) for Q4 2013, worth a combined $8.71B — up 0.39% from $8.68B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 67 funds opened new SRCL positions and 19 closed out — a net gain of 48 holders — while 192 added to existing stakes and 200 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Janus Henderson Investors US, adding an estimated $54.8M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$73.1M.
